Human mortality due to drug-resistant infections is becoming more prevalent in our society. Antibiotics are impotent due to abuse and/or misuse, leading to new, more expensive, and more effective medicines and treatments. Therefore, it causes many short-term and long-term side effects in the patient. On the other hand, nanoparticles have exhibited antibacterial activity against various pathogens due to their small size and ability to destroy cells by various mechanisms. Unlike antibiotics for the treatment of patients' diseases and infections, nanomaterials provide an exciting way to limit the growth of microorganisms due to infections in humans. This has led to the development of a number of nanoparticles as active antibacterial agents. Therefore, the authors have carefully reviewed the recent developments in the use of nanomaterials for antibacterial applications and the mechanisms that make them an effective alternate antibacterial agent.

Space travel is an extreme experience even for the astronaut who has received extensive basic training in various fields, from aeronautics to engineering, from medicine to physics and biology. Microgravity puts a strain on members of space crews, both physically and mentally: short-term or long-term travel in orbit the International Space Station may have serious repercussions on the human body, which may undergo physiological changes affecting almost all organs and systems, particularly at the muscular, cardiovascular and bone compartments. This review aims to highlight recent studies describing damages of human body induced by the space environment for microgravity, and radiation. All novel conditions, to ally unknown to the Darwinian selection strategies on Earth, to which we should add the psychological stress that astronauts suffer due to the inevitable forced cohabitation in claustrophobic environments, the deprivation from their affections and the need to adapt to a new lifestyle with molecular changes due to the confinement. In this context, significant nutritional deficiencies with consequent molecular mechanism changes in the cells that induce to the onset of physiological and cognitive impairment have been considered.

Abstract Technological development put international organisations to effort in order to issue and continuously reassess standards concerning electromagnetic radiation protection issues. Protection standards have to be continuously reviewed as new data become available. This article provides a brief overview of updates implemented by the latest available protection standards. Currently, standards do not incorporate appropriate safety factors for protection against long-term effects of exposure to electromagnetic fields, thus protection is provided only for the established short term effects of electromagnetic fields on the human body. However, there is still a great deal of questions related to differences in limitations set by international organisations that have issued recommendations for personnel protection against electromagnetic fields.

Recent developments in airline strategies have resulted in important changes in both airfares and services offered to tourists. Analyses of the impacts of the latest changes are only now emerging, usually in fairly general terms. The consequences for specific destinations, particularly those that may be a bit outside the norm, have not been considered. This discussion sets out to identify some important changes in the airline industry and to consider their likely impacts on the demand for tourist destinations. The focus is on strategic, that is relatively long-term, developments in the airline industry, rather than short-term or singular effects, such as the impacts of the 9/11 terrorist attacks (although these can be seen in the examples). The Balearic Islands (Spain) and Adelaide (Australia) are considered as widely differing regional cases in assessing how destinations can be affected by these airline strategic developments.

AbstractRapid serial visual presentation (RSVP) of words or pictured scenes provides evidence for a large-capacity conceptual short-term memory (CSTM) that momentarily provides rich associated material from long-term memory, permitting rapid chunking (Potter 1993; 2009; 2012). In perception of scenes as well as language comprehension, we make use of knowledge that briefly exceeds the supposed limits of working memory.

Previous short term toxicological studies of one to two weeks duration have demonstrated that MDL 19,660 (5-(4-chlorophenyl)-2,4-dihydro-2,4-dimethyl-3Hl, 2,4-triazole-3-thione), an antidepressant drug, causes a dose-related thrombocytopenia in dogs. Platelet counts started to decline after two days of dosing with 30 mg/kg/day and continued to decrease to their lowest levels by 5-7 days. The loss in platelets was primarily of the small discoid subpopulation. In vitro studies have also indicated that MDL 19,660: does not spontaneously aggregate canine platelets and has moderate antiaggregating properties by inhibiting ADP-induced aggregation. The objectives of the present investigation of MDL 19,660 were to evaluate ultrastructurally long term effects on platelet internal architecture and changes in subpopulations of platelets and megakaryocytes.Nine male and nine female beagle dogs were divided equally into three groups and were administered orally 0, 15, or 30 mg/kg/day of MDL 19,660 for three months. Compared to a control platelet range of 353,000- 452,000/μl, a doserelated thrombocytopenia reached a maximum severity of an average of 135,000/μl for the 15 mg/kg/day dogs after two weeks and 81,000/μl for the 30 mg/kg/day dogs after one week.

Objectives School-age children with and without parent-reported listening difficulties (LiD) were compared on auditory processing, language, memory, and attention abilities. The objective was to extend what is known so far in the literature about children with LiD by using multiple measures and selective novel measures across the above areas. Design Twenty-six children who were reported by their parents as having LiD and 26 age-matched typically developing children completed clinical tests of auditory processing and multiple measures of language, attention, and memory. All children had normal-range pure-tone hearing thresholds bilaterally. Group differences were examined. Results In addition to significantly poorer speech-perception-in-noise scores, children with LiD had reduced speed and accuracy of word retrieval from long-term memory, poorer short-term memory, sentence recall, and inferencing ability. Statistically significant group differences were of moderate effect size; however, standard test scores of children with LiD were not clinically poor. No statistically significant group differences were observed in attention, working memory capacity, vocabulary, and nonverbal IQ. Conclusions Mild signal-to-noise ratio loss, as reflected by the group mean of children with LiD, supported the children's functional listening problems. In addition, children's relative weakness in select areas of language performance, short-term memory, and long-term memory lexical retrieval speed and accuracy added to previous research on evidence-based areas that need to be evaluated in children with LiD who almost always have heterogenous profiles. Importantly, the functional difficulties faced by children with LiD in relation to their test results indicated, to some extent, that commonly used assessments may not be adequately capturing the children's listening challenges.
